Wagering Requirements: The Math
Let’s break down the wagering on the Zumibet Casino 80 free spins sign up bonus Australia. The 40x requirement applies to the bonus winnings, not the deposit. This is better than some offers that apply wagering to the deposit plus bonus.
Example:
- You win $15 from the free spins.
- Wagering requirement: $15 x 40 = $600.
- You must place bets totaling $600 before you can withdraw.
- Only pokies contribute 100% to wagering. Table games contribute 10% or less.
This means you should stick to pokies to clear the wagering efficiently. If you try to clear it on blackjack, you’ll be playing for hours. The maximum bet allowed during wagering is $5 per spin. Exceeding that voids the bonus.
